Tool Primary Function How It Supports Responsible Play
Deposit Limits Pre-set maximum funding amounts Prevents overspending by capping deposits per day, week, or month before play begins.
Reality Checks / Session Reminders Timed notifications during play Interrupts automatic play to provide time and money spent data, prompting conscious decision-making.
Loss Limits & Wager Limits Controls on losses or bet sizes Adds a secondary layer of protection by limiting potential loss per session or the size of individual bets.
Self-Exclusion & Time-Outs Temporary or long-term account suspension Allows for a mandatory cooling-off period (days, weeks, months) or longer-term exclusion to break problematic patterns.
Transaction History Access Detailed, real-time financial record Enables transparent tracking of all deposits, wagers, and withdrawals, fostering financial awareness.

Leveraging Built-In Tools: Deposit Limits as Your Digital Guardian

Recognizing that willpower alone can be tested in the heat of the moment, reputable platforms operating under Canadian regulations provide concrete, technological safeguards. The most powerful of these responsible gambling tools are customizable deposit limits. These are not suggestions; they are hard-coded financial ceilings you set within your account settings, acting as an impartial, automated barrier against impulsive overspending. At Rocket Riches casino, you can typically establish daily, weekly, or monthly limits, tailoring them to your personal cash flow and comfort level. The psychological relief this provides cannot be overstated. Once set, these limits create a mandatory cooling-off period once reached, forcing a pause that allows rationality to re-engage. Crucially, decreasing a limit is usually instant, but increasing or removing one often involves a mandatory waiting period,a critical design feature that prevents rash decisions during emotional gameplay. This system empowers you to play with confidence, knowing a pre-committed safety net is firmly in place.

To operationalize these principles, integrate the following actionable steps into your routine:

  • Conduct a Pre-Session Audit: Before launching any game, decisively determine the absolute maximum amount you are prepared to lose for that session. This is your session bankroll. Guard it fiercely.
  • Segment Your Funds: Divide your session bankroll into smaller units, or “betting units,” ensuring no single wager exceeds a small percentage (e.g., 1-5%). This mitigates risk and dramatically extends your playtime.
  • Utilize All Account Tools: Immediately navigate to your account’s responsible gaming section and set deposit limits that reflect your overall monthly entertainment budget. Also explore session time reminders and loss limits.
  • Embrace the Cash-Out: Define a profit goal-a point at which you will withdraw a portion of your winnings. This locks in success and transforms abstract gains into tangible rewards.
  • Maintain a Gaming Log: Keep a simple record of your sessions: deposits, withdrawals, time played, and final balance. This objective data reveals patterns invisible in the moment.
